- The distance between Zagreb, Croatia and Columbia, Mo, Usa is approximately 8,200 km or 5,096 mi.
- To reach Zagreb in this distance one would set out from Columbia, Mo bearing 43.6°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Zagreb bearing 129.6° or SE .
- Zagreb has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Columbia, Mo has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 0.8 °C (1.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.6 °C (11.9°F) less in Zagreb.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 109.1 mm (4.3 in) less which is equivalent to 109.1 l/m² (2.68 US gal/ft²) or 1,091,000 l/ha (116,635 US gal/ac) less. About 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7° lower in Zagreb than in Columbia, Mo.
